Tamil Film 'Karuppu' Starring Suriya and Trisha Krishnan to Stream on Amazon Prime from June 12

The courtroom drama starring Suriya and Trisha Krishnan will be available for streaming worldwide.

The critically acclaimed Tamil film 'Karuppu,' starring Suriya and Trisha Krishnan, will be available for streaming on Amazon Prime starting June 12. The movie, directed by R.J. Balaji, combines mythological elements, courtroom drama, and commercial action. It features Suriya as the deity Vettai Karuppu, who takes human form as a lawyer to fight against corruption in the judicial system.

'Karuppu' was a massive success at the box office, grossing over 300 crore rupees worldwide since its release on May 15. It is now Suriya's highest-grossing film, surpassing his previous record with 'Singham 2' (2013). The film will be available in Tamil, Hindi, Malayalam, and Kannada, with a Telugu version titled 'VeerabhadruDu.'

Suriya expressed his gratitude for the film's success, hoping more global audiences would enjoy it. Critics attribute the film's success to its unique story, use of folklore, and courtroom drama, offering both a new experience and a social message to Tamil audiences.
